About Us
Lumida is an innovative cybersecurity startup redefining how organizations manage security risk through agentic AI. Our platform acts as a digital team member for security teams—ingesting contextual data from dozens of tools and environments, reasoning over risk, and driving decisions around prioritization, remediation, and strategy.
We’re solving deeply complex enterprise problems, building from the ground up with AI-native design, and turning decades of noisy vulnerability data into high-impact, action-ready insights.
About the Role
We're looking for a UX/Product Designer to help shape the interface of our agentic AI platform—built for security teams operating in high-stakes, high-noise environments. You’ll own the design of flows that span vulnerability triage, remediation planning, and contextual decision support. Your work will define how our users interact with autonomous agents, AI-suggested plans, and dynamic threat insights.
This role is ideal for someone who’s designed enterprise software at scale and deeply understands the workflows of technical users—security analysts, penetration testers, and vulnerability management leads.
